ITSMILNER wrote:
Squinty wrote:I will begrudgingly add that even though Meat Circus.


I've seen Meat Circus mentioned before, whats the issue with it?


It's a level near the end of the game which was insanely hard. It's a timed escort mission with tight platforming sections. The game doesn't really have tight enough controls for it to feel all that fair. Plus the difficulty curve was ridiculous in comparison to the rest of the game.

Every time Psychonauts is brought up, I think about it and I get flashbacks. I think it's the angriest a video game has ever made me. I literally threw the disc out my bedroom window, I was that annoyed.

The PC version has apparently made it easier.
